Proximie Limited
Proximie | The leading healthcare platform for improving patient outcomes and driving productivity.
Proximie enables healthcare organizations, surgeons, and medical device companies to improve patient safety, scale training efforts, and accelerate device adoption, all while driving substantial savings in cost and time.

Proximie Live Plus
1 May 2019 to 31 Mar 2022
Proximie will develop an innovative and easy to deploy remote real time AR collaboration and assessment platform for use during bowel cancer screening colonoscopies.
